Agera

Agera is a village located in Ranapur tehsil of Jhabua district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 17km away from sub-district headquarter Ranapur (tehsildar office) and 37km away from district headquarter Jhabua. As per 2009 stats, Agera village is also a gram panchayat.

About Agera

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Agera is 504907. The village spans a total geographical area of 811.3 hectares. Ranapur is nearest town to Agera village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 17km away.

Population of Agera

According to the 2011 Census, Agera has a total population of about 1,311, with approximately 680 males and 631 females. The sex ratio is around 927 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 306 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 6 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 1,294. The overall literacy rate is approximately 13.73%, with male literacy at about 17.79% and female literacy near 9.35%. There are around 247 households in the village. Connectivity of Agera

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Agera. As per the 2011 stats, Agera had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Private Bus Service Available within village
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
